Description

This classic text focuses on elliptic boundary value problems in domains with nonsmooth boundaries and on problems with mixed boundary conditions. Its contents are essential for an understanding of the behavior of numerical methods for partial differential equations (PDEs) on two-dimensional domains with corners.

Elliptic Problems in Nonsmooth Domains

• provides a careful and self-contained development of Sobolev spaces on nonsmooth domains,

• develops a comprehensive theory for second-order elliptic boundary value problems, and

• addresses fourth-order boundary value problems and numerical treatment of singularities.

Excerpt

Since the publication of Pierre Grisvard's monograph in 1985, the theory of elliptic problems in nonsmooth domains has become increasingly important for research in partial differential equations and their numerical solutions. While significant advances have occurred during the last two decades, Grisvard's monograph remains an excellent introduction to the subject and a good source for the basic material.
